引言
编程,作为现代科技的核心,已经渗透到我们生活的方方面面。对于初学者来说,编程可能显得有些神秘和复杂。但不用担心,本文将带你从零开始,通过图解的方式,轻松掌握编程的奥秘。
第一部分:认识编程
1.1 什么是编程?
编程,简单来说,就是用计算机语言告诉计算机如何执行任务的过程。就像我们用中文交流一样,编程就是用代码与计算机沟通。
1.2 编程语言
目前,世界上有成千上万种编程语言,但常见的有Python、Java、C++等。每种语言都有其特点和适用场景。
第二部分:编程环境搭建
2.1 安装编程软件
首先,我们需要安装一个编程软件,也就是集成开发环境(IDE)。例如,Python的PyCharm、Java的Eclipse等。
2.2 配置编程环境
安装好IDE后,我们还需要配置一些必要的库和工具,以便更好地进行编程。
第三部分:编程基础语法
3.1 变量和数据类型
变量是编程中的基本概念,它可以存储数据。数据类型包括整数、浮点数、字符串等。
3.2 控制语句
控制语句用于控制程序的执行流程,如条件语句(if、else)、循环语句(for、while)等。
3.3 函数
函数是可重复使用的代码块,它可以提高代码的可读性和可维护性。
第四部分:编程实战
4.1 编写第一个程序
以下是一个简单的Python程序,用于计算两个数的和:
# 计算两个数的和
def add_numbers(a, b):
return a + b
# 主函数
def main():
num1 = 5
num2 = 3
result = add_numbers(num1, num2)
print("两个数的和为:", result)
# 程序入口
if __name__ == "__main__":
main()
4.2 常见编程问题及解决方法
在编程过程中,我们可能会遇到各种问题。以下是一些常见问题及解决方法:
- 语法错误:仔细检查代码,确保没有拼写错误或符号错误。
- 逻辑错误:检查算法的正确性,确保程序按照预期执行。
- 运行时错误:查看错误信息,根据提示进行排查。
第五部分:编程进阶
5.1 面向对象编程
面向对象编程(OOP)是一种编程范式,它将数据和行为封装在一起。常见的面向对象编程语言有Java、C++、Python等。
5.2 版本控制
版本控制可以帮助我们管理代码的变更,常见的版本控制系统有Git。
总结
通过本文的介绍,相信你已经对编程有了初步的了解。编程是一个充满挑战和乐趣的过程,希望你能不断学习,探索编程的奥秘。
